Start by matching the material to the project’s function: prioritize strength and compaction for driveways, good drainage for paths and beds, and appearance for patios and decorative areas. Consider traffic load, slope, and local climate; use our aggregate quiz or talk to our experts to narrow choices. Order a little extra to account for compaction and grading.
Materials are delivered by local, contracted dump truck fleets (typically tri-axle) and require clear access for safe dumping and turnaround. Confirm there is sufficient overhead and surface clearance, and plan where you want materials placed; drivers may offer tailgate spreading at their discretion but this is not guaranteed. We handle scheduling and supplier coordination, but final delivery placement and site safety are evaluated by the driver on arrival.

Permit and HOA rules vary by city, neighborhood, and the scope of work; many simple deliveries need no permit, while projects that alter drainage, create new driveways, or add retaining walls may. Check local building codes and your HOA guidelines before ordering and note any restrictions in your order notes so the supplier and driver can plan accordingly. If you’re unsure, contact your local municipal office, HOA, or our sales team for guidance.
